It sounds concerning to notice something unusual during your personal hygiene routine. Based on your description, it's possible that what you felt could be a hemorrhoid, a skin tag, or even an anal polyp, rather than a tapeworm. Here's a breakdown to consider:
What Could It Be?
- Hemorrhoids: These are swollen blood vessels in the rectal area and can protrude during or after a bowel movement, often causing discomfort or bleeding.
- Skin Tags: Sometimes, extra skin can develop around the anal area, which may be mistaken for something more serious.
- Anal Polyps: Non-cancerous growths in the rectal area could also protrude if they become irritated or inflamed.
Next Steps
- Observe Symptoms: Keep an eye on any additional symptoms like pain, bleeding, or changes in bowel habits.
- Gentle Cleaning: Continue to maintain proper hygiene to keep the area clean, avoiding any harsh scrubbing. Use soft toilet paper or moistened wipes.
- Avoid Probing: Resist pulling or prodding the area further to avoid irritation or causing potential injury.
- Monitor Changes: If the protrusion reappears, changes in size, or if you experience any discomfort, note these symptoms.
Reassurance
While it’s natural to worry about unusual changes in the body, many causes are benign and treatable.
